Tool-Einführung

A multi-purpose line manipulation tool. Sort alphabetically or by length, remove duplicate lines (case-sensitive or not), reverse the order, reverse each line's text, shuffle, strip blank lines, trim whitespace, number lines, or wrap each line with a prefix and suffix — all in one place.

Tool-Überblick

Every developer and writer keeps a hidden tab open for sorting a list, deleting duplicates, or numbering rows. This tool collects the common one-liners into a single page so you don't have to hop between sites. All operations run client-side and preserve your original text — change the operation and the output regenerates instantly.

Anwendungsfälle

  • Sort a list of imports, dependencies, or env keys alphabetically
  • Remove duplicate emails from a contact list before importing
  • Number a checklist for a meeting
  • Reverse a stack-trace top-to-bottom for readability
  • Shuffle a list of names for random draws
  • Wrap each line of a list in quotes for code or SQL pasting

FAQ

Is the sort stable?+
Yes. Modern browser sort implementations are stable, so equal items keep their relative order.
What's the difference between 'reverse order' and 'reverse text'?+
Reverse order flips the list bottom-to-top while keeping each line intact. Reverse text flips the characters inside every line.
Does shuffle use cryptographically secure randomness?+
It uses Math.random with Fisher-Yates — fine for non-security shuffles like sampling. For raffles or security-sensitive picks, use a dedicated secure random tool.
Are case-insensitive comparisons locale-aware?+
Yes. Sorting uses Intl.Collator-style localeCompare, so accented characters and non-Latin scripts collate correctly for your locale.
